Carl Macek, Father of 'Robotech' (1951-2010)
Jerry Beck at Cartoon Brew broke the news that his former Streamline Pictures co-founder and "creator" of Toonami cornerstone Robotech, passed away of a heart attack Saturday, April 17th.
Among other animation projects throughout his career in addition to adapting Robotech for Harmony Gold in 1984, Mr. Macek helped Ren & Stimpy creator John Kricfalusi start his Spumco animation studio as well as co-founding anime film distributor Streamline Pictures.
Mr. Macek had also recently worked on English script adaptations for Naruto and Bleach.
Mr. Beck summed it up best- "Carl had his critics. But one thing is certain: the popularity of anime in the North America [sic] would not be where it is today without Macek's groundbreaking work on Robotech and his efforts on behalf of Streamline Pictures."
R.I.P. and thank you Mr. Macek.

Because YOU Demanded It! Naruto Shippuden on TV [Updated]
Just not on Cartoon Network.
Viz Media has announced that Naruto Shippuden has been acquired by Disney-ABC Cable Networks Group for debut on their Disney XD television channel beginning in October. The actual premiere date has not yet been announced. Daikun informs us that the premiere is set for October 28th at 8:30 PM.
Disney XD's stated target audience is boys ages 6-14, (what we always hoped a full-time Toonami channel could have been, minus the live-action content) and it is hoped that Shippuden will be successful for them.
